Some of the physical signs of crack abuse include: Dilated pupils. Insomnia. Increased heart rate. Hypertension (raised blood pressure). Suppressed appetite and weight loss. Fasciculations / twitching of the muscles. Nosebleeds. Other signs of crack abuse to look for include: Frequent disappearances (to get high) Dilated pupils. Aggressive behavior. Restlessness. Increased breathing rate. Uncharacteristic irresponsibility. Cracked or blistered lips from smoking out of a hot pipe. Burns on fingers. As crack smoke does not remain potent for long, crack pipes are generally very short. This often causes cracked and blistered lips, known as “crack lip," from users having a very hot pipe pressed against their lips. “The only thing on my mind was crack cocaine. Crack cocaine is a powerful substance that is the result of a chemical reaction which occurs when cocaine is mixed with ammonia and other chemicals and heated. The name "crack" comes from the sound that the drug makes when it is smoked.
